Samsung Galaxy S23 or S23+: which is more resistant to falls?

Smartphones are increasingly amazing pieces of engineering, but ones that we must treat with care. This is because they may not hold up to drops like we expect.

Since you never know tomorrow, my advice is to always use a case on your smartphone. You protect your investment and avoid scares. And it seems that this is quite valid for the new Galaxy S23 Ultra and S23+.

Recently, the Galaxy S23 Ultra went through the popular drop test on the PBKReviews YouTube channel. And it was not in the best way, since the smartphone broke in the first fall that was made in the waist area.

Samsung Galaxy S23 Ultra and S23+ have Gorilla Glass Victus 2

It should be remembered that the Galaxy S23 Ultra has the latest version of Gorilla Glass Victus 2. But even that did not prevent it from breaking on the first drop. And you might think it was just because it had a curved screen on the sides.

But the sibling Galaxy S23+, also with Gorilla Glass Victus 2, broke in the same kind of drop. As you can see in the video below, it remained touch-responsive and displayed content without any issues.

These videos show that both pieces of equipment can be fragile when exposed to these types of drops. So a cover and/or a tempered glass film on your screen will only do them good, and leave you more relaxed.
